Culinary Delights of Andalusia

Granada: Walking Food Tour - Culinary Delights of Andalusia

Indulge in a culinary adventure through the vibrant flavors of Andalusia on the Granada Food Tour, where every bite tells a story of tradition and innovation.

The Andalusian flavors are a delightful blend of history and creativity, reflecting the rich culinary traditions of the region. From the famous Jamón Ibérico to the refreshing Tinto de Verano, each taste evokes a sense of place and culture.

Local dishes like the traditional Albondigas and Salmorejo showcase the depth of Andalusian cuisine, with influences from Moorish and Mediterranean cooking styles.

The tour offers a unique opportunity to immerse in these authentic flavors, experiencing firsthand the passion and heritage behind Andalusia’s gastronomy.

Savoring Local Wines and Hams

Granada: Walking Food Tour - Savoring Local Wines and Hams

Savor the rich flavors of local wines and hams in Granada, Spain, where traditional culinary delights await to tantalize your palate. When exploring Granada’s culinary scene, visitors can expect a delightful experience centered around local wineries and ham tastings. Here’s what to look forward to:

  1. Local Wineries: Dive into the world of Granada’s winemaking tradition by sampling a variety of local wines, including the renowned Tinto de Verano.

  2. Ham Tastings: Indulge in the savory goodness of different hams, from the flavorful Serrano from Granada to the prestigious Iberian ham.

  3. Culinary Delights: Enjoy the fusion of flavors as you pair these exquisite hams and wines with local recipes at establishments like the historic Chikito restaurant.
